The fbi begins an investigation. A timeline suggests some answers. Epstein was arrested again on july 6, 2019, on federal charges for the sex trafficking of minors in florida and new york
He died in his jail cell on august 10, 2019
When did jeffrey epstein get caught Epstein was first arrested in july 2006 on a single count of soliciting prostitution. Executive summary jeffrey epstein's first documented criminal arrest came in july 2006, when a grand jury in palm beach, florida, returned an indictment. Jeffrey epstein is arrested at teterboro airport in new jersey and taken into federal custody. It's been more than six years since the death of convicted sex offender jeffrey epstein From the moment he first faced criminal charges, in 2006, jeffrey epstein has been the object of public fascination, conspiracy theories and outrage — especially after his lawyers got prosecutors to agree to a lenient plea deal that spared him from serious prison time. Questions persist about how jeffrey epstein, who once moved among the world's elite, was able to avoid federal prosecution for so long
